Java数据库连接驱动介绍:SQL Server JDBC
需积分: 10 14 浏览量
更新于2024-11-18
收藏 1.01MB ZIP 举报
资源摘要信息:"Java连接数据库所需驱动"
Java作为一种广泛使用的编程语言,其应用领域之一就是数据库的连接与操作。数据库是存储、管理、处理和检索数据的系统,它对于各种应用程序来说都是不可或缺的组件。为了在Java中操作数据库,Java提供了一套标准的数据库连接接口——Java Database Connectivity (JDBC)。JDBC是Java语言的一个标准扩展,它允许Java应用程序通过一种统一的方式来连接并操作各种数据库。
JDBC驱动是连接Java应用和数据库的桥梁。不同的数据库厂商提供了不同的驱动实现,以保证Java应用程序能够通过JDBC接口与各自的数据库系统进行交互。驱动程序负责将Java应用程序中的SQL语句转换为数据库能够理解并执行的命令。
对于SQL Server数据库,Java开发者可以使用微软官方提供的JDBC驱动程序。在文件名称列表中,我们看到了两个与SQL Server JDBC驱动相关的文件名:sqljdbc4.jar 和 sqljdbc.jar。这两个文件是JDBC驱动的不同版本,它们都包含了连接到SQL Server所需的所有类和方法。
sqljdbc4.jar是基于Java 7及以上版本的驱动程序,它支持JDBC 4.0规范,并且能够在Java 7的环境中使用。它利用了Java SE 7中的特性,例如try-with-resources语句,来简化资源管理。这个版本的驱动兼容Windows平台上的SQL Server 2008、SQL Server 2008 R2、SQL Server 2012等版本。
sqljdbc.jar则是适用于Java 6的驱动版本,它支持JDBC 3.0规范。这个驱动同样兼容较早版本的SQL Server数据库。开发者需要根据所使用Java版本以及SQL Server数据库版本的不同,选择合适的驱动版本进行开发。
在实际开发中,开发者需要将选定的JDBC驱动jar文件添加到项目的类路径(classpath)中,以便Java虚拟机(JVM)能够找到并加载JDBC驱动类。这可以通过在项目构建工具(如Maven或Gradle)的配置文件中添加依赖项来实现,或者在IDE(如Eclipse或IntelliJ IDEA)中直接添加jar文件到项目的构建路径。
除了微软官方提供的JDBC驱动之外,还有一些第三方驱动,例如jTDS和HikariCP,这些也经常被用于SQL Server数据库的连接。不过,微软的原生驱动通常是最推荐的选项,因为它们能够提供最稳定的性能和最佳的兼容性。
了解和掌握如何使用JDBC驱动连接和操作数据库是Java开发者的基本技能之一。开发者在实际工作中,还需要熟悉SQL语言,以及如何使用JDBC API编写高效、安全的数据库访问代码。此外,为了提高数据库操作的性能,避免资源泄漏,还需要掌握连接池技术,合理管理数据库连接资源。
总结来说,Java连接数据库驱动是实现Java应用程序与数据库交互的必备组件。特别是对于SQL Server数据库,正确选择和使用合适的JDBC驱动是成功连接数据库的关键步骤。通过上述知识点的学习和实践,开发者能够更加熟练地在Java应用中实现复杂的数据库操作。
点击了解资源详情
2017-08-29 上传
2020-08-06 上传
2023-08-22 上传
2010-04-22 上传
2011-09-07 上传
2012-10-28 上传
嗷呜嗷~
- 粉丝: 0
- 资源: 5
最新资源
- JHU荣誉单变量微积分课程教案介绍
- Naruto爱好者必备CLI测试应用
- Android应用显示Ignaz-Taschner-Gymnasium取消课程概览
- ASP学生信息档案管理系统毕业设计及完整源码
- Java商城源码解析:酒店管理系统快速开发指南
- 构建可解析文本框:.NET 3.5中实现文本解析与验证
- Java语言打造任天堂红白机模拟器—nes4j解析
- 基于Hadoop和Hive的网络流量分析工具介绍
- Unity实现帝国象棋:从游戏到复刻
- WordPress文档嵌入插件:无需浏览器插件即可上传和显示文档
- Android开源项目精选:优秀项目篇
- 黑色设计商务酷站模板 - 网站构建新选择
- Rollup插件去除JS文件横幅:横扫许可证头
- AngularDart中Hammock服务的使用与REST API集成
- 开源AVR编程器:高效、低成本的微控制器编程解决方案
- Anya Keller 图片组合的开发部署记录